| package geode.kafka.source; |
| |
| import java.util.concurrent.BlockingQueue; |
| import java.util.concurrent.LinkedBlockingQueue; |
| import java.util.function.Supplier; |
| |
| public class SharedEventBufferSupplier implements EventBufferSupplier { |
| |
| private static BlockingQueue<GeodeEvent> eventBuffer; |
| |
| public SharedEventBufferSupplier(int size) { |
| recreateEventBufferIfNeeded(size); |
| } |
| |
| BlockingQueue recreateEventBufferIfNeeded(int size) { |
| if (eventBuffer == null || (eventBuffer.size() + eventBuffer.remainingCapacity()) != size) { |
| synchronized (GeodeKafkaSource.class) { |
| if (eventBuffer == null || (eventBuffer.size() + eventBuffer.remainingCapacity()) != size) { |
| BlockingQueue<GeodeEvent> oldEventBuffer = eventBuffer; |
| eventBuffer = new LinkedBlockingQueue<>(size); |
| if (oldEventBuffer != null) { |
| eventBuffer.addAll(oldEventBuffer); |
| } |
| } |
| } |
| } |
| return eventBuffer; |
| } |
| |
| /** |
| * Callers should not store a reference to this and instead always call get to make sure we always use the latest buffer |
| * Buffers themselves shouldn't change often but in cases where we want to modify the size |
| */ |
| public BlockingQueue<GeodeEvent> get() { |
| return eventBuffer; |
| } |
| } |
